I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at BDO (Newcastle, England) in Nov 2023
Interview
It was quite good. An automative video interview and assessment. The assessment questions had a verbal reasoning and mathematical aptitude test. A phycological assessment was also included. It was a bit challenging.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
They asked me about a challenge i faced in my career and how I dealt with it.
UK Graduate London based. Online assesments followed by a Hirevue video interview which contained four basic competency and behavioural questions. Similar to all graduate early stage interview processes. Believe there is a bank of questions from which they ask 4.
